An elderly man is fighting for his life after crashing his car while parking.

It is thought the 74-year-old may have become unwell at the wheel before the "low-speed" collision on Venlaw View in Peebles, Borders, on Thursday.

The man was parking his Suzuki Splash when it struck a parked Renault Twingo around 10.45am.

He was taken to Borders General Hospital where he remains in a critical condition.

Police appealed for anyone with information to come forward.

Sergeant Gary Taylor said: "At this time, we believe the driver of the Suzuki may have taken unwell behind the wheel, resulting in the collision.

"However, as part of our ongoing inquiries we are keen to speak to anyone who was in the area and witnessed what happened.

"If you believe you have information that can assist with our investigation the please contact police immediately."
